Subject: Inkwell markdown pipeline 5.1 deployed

On-call: the Inkwell rendering pipeline is now on 5.1 in production. Changes: sanitizer runs before the table parser, footnote rendering is cached per document, and the fallback plain-text path no longer strips headings. If render latency alarms fire, roll back via the standard script — it handles cache invalidation. Known issue: nested blockquotes over six levels render flat. The deployment trace token follows.

build token for hawep-kageg: htk14_558814e2114cc7

**Ticket: Digestly batch scheduler firing at the wrong hour**

For the sync: Digestly's batch email digests went out at 3am local instead of 8am because staging copied prod's .env minus half the values. We need DIGEST_CRON="0 8 * * *" and TZ_DEFAULT=market-local set explicitly, not inherited. Also SCHEDULER_POOL=4 so retries don't pile up. While we're fixing the file, the scheduler also needs its queue credential, so append that line right after.

vault entry, yajop-bafop: ARCHIVE_KEY3=8d4

### RateSentry: parity check loop

Scope: compare our published rates on Lanternkey against partner channels every cycle. Out-of-parity rows get flagged, not auto-corrected — that's a later phase. You own the scraper cadence and the tolerance thresholds; don't touch the alerting layer. Keep request pacing conservative; the Bryce Harbor pilot got throttled twice last quarter. Tolerances are percentage-based, pacing is in seconds. Read the tuning table before changing anything. Current constants follow.

tuning table, taguf-kaduf:
TIERS = {
    "drudor": 562,
    "ulaael": 30,
    "brieth": 879,
}

// Deep-link routing client for the Quillhop app (eng sync notes).
// All inbound links hit the Fernway resolver first, which maps
// short paths to screen intents. Fallback: open the home tab,
// never a webview. Resolver timeout is 400ms — below that users
// notice jank, per last week's metrics review. Staging resolver
// shares the prod routing table but a separate credential pool.
// The resolver rejects unauthenticated calls; init the client
// with the key below.

service key, kaduf-bawig: kto15_Ze79S0dligTw0yO